决策支持系统:数据库模型详解

需积分: 10 3 下载量 42 浏览量 更新于2024-09-17 1 收藏 260KB PDF 举报
"该资源是《决策支持系统》课程的第4章——数据库系统相关的课件,涵盖了数据库开发、决策支持系统(DDS)数据库建立等多个主题。内容包括数据模型的类型,如层次、网状和关系模型的介绍,以及数据库设计、DSS数据库设计和数据询问技术。此外,还强调了数据库管理在DSS中的重要性,并具体阐述了数据模型的三大要素:数据结构、数据操作和数据约束条件。" 在深入讨论决策支持系统(DSS)的背景下,数据库系统是其核心组成部分。本课件首先介绍了数据模型的概念,它是数据库系统的基础,用于对现实世界的抽象和表达。数据模型主要包含三个要素:数据结构描述了数据的静态特性,数据操作描述了数据如何变化,而数据约束条件则规定了数据的完整性规则。 在数据模型的类型中,传统模型包括层次模型、网状模型和关系模型。层次模型以树形结构呈现数据,有一个根节点和多个子节点;网状模型允许节点有多重父节点,展现更复杂的关系;关系模型是最常见的,基于表格形式,由关系、关系操作集合和关系完整性规则组成。关系操作包括选择、投影、连接等集合运算。 DSS数据库设计则关注如何根据DSS的需求来构建数据库,这涉及到对业务逻辑、数据流和查询性能的考虑。数据询问技术则涉及到用户如何高效地从数据库中获取信息,可能包括SQL查询、OLAP(在线分析处理)操作或其他高级查询机制。 数据库管理在DSS中的意义在于确保数据的准确、一致和可用性,这对于支持决策过程至关重要。良好的数据库管理能够提供可靠的数据基础,支持决策者做出明智的判断。 此外,课件还提到了规则模型,这是一种适用于处理复杂计算关系的数据模型。规则模型的操作包括创建、更新、删除规则,以及检索和应用规则。"使用规则"操作允许根据预定义的规则进行计算,这对于决策支持系统中涉及逻辑推理和预测分析的场景特别有用。 这个课件详细讲解了数据库系统的基础知识,特别是如何将这些知识应用于决策支持系统,对于学习理解和构建DSS的人员来说是一份宝贵的资料。